Output cfd113da1e783a0366d801be88e22c05169bae3a1598f09c7f544a3e40cf42fa:0

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a26b5d054243e6c2d487266f4a39e71b2eadf5d6 OP_EQUALVERIFY OP_CHECKSIG
address
1Foo5pCAKrJC6gEYkz34Ktj8NxcJdGUBL9
transaction
cfd113da1e783a0366d801be88e22c05169bae3a1598f09c7f544a3e40cf42fa
spent
true